People v. DeMauro

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Fourth Department
Mar 13, 1992
181 A.D.2d 1076 (N.Y. App. Div. 1992)

Opinion

March 13, 1992

Present — Denman, P.J., Green, Pine, Balio and Fallon, JJ.


Motion to dismiss appeal as waived denied. Memorandum: Inasmuch as the plea minutes do not indicate that defendant understood that he was waiving the right to appeal as part of the plea bargain, the waiver is not enforceable (see, People v Moissett, 76 N.Y.2d 909).
